## v3.8.2 — Vendored third-party fonts

All display and body fonts used by the Pennwright report generator are now vendored under `assets/fonts/` instead of being fetched at build time from the Glyphhaven CDN. This removes a flaky network dependency that caused intermittent build failures on the Marlow CI cluster. License files ship alongside each family; verify they remain in place after any font update. If a rendering regression appears at runtime, roll back to v3.8.1 and page the change owner identified below.

named custodian: Quenael Briax

## Service Accounts — Migrations

Zero-downtime schema migrations on Varnholt run through the `drift-runner` service account. It applies expand/contract steps, never destructive DDL, and backfills in 10k-row batches. If a migration stalls, pause via the runner console before paging the Varnholt team. The runner authenticates with the internal key below.

service key, yadug-bajog: zpat3_pou

- [ ] Hardware lab access (Building 3, Room 3.14). Contractors must complete the static-safety briefing video before entry; the lab steward on duty will confirm completion. Tools stay inside the lab; sign all loaned equipment in and out at the bench log. The lab door is kept locked at all times. Enter the lab using the door code printed below.

door code, kawip-bagap: bdg-HQEWH-4

**Ticket: Quota config drift between regions**

The Meterline service applies per-tenant rate quotas, but the eastern region has drifted from the canonical set after a manual hotfix. New team members: never edit quotas directly on hosts; changes go through the quota repo. For comparison, the canonical production values are as follows.

deployment values, taweg-bajop:
[fenvan]
port = 5672
team = holmir
host = fenvan.orvexio.example
region = lower-1
access_code = ac_b98bc6
timeout_ms = 1500